Ingredients List

Gather up these delicious ingredients to make your One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o. I promise, they’re straightforward and easy to find!

  • 2 chicken breasts: Boneless and skinless for the best texture and flavor.
  • 1 cup orzo pasta: This tiny pasta shape soaks up all the yummy flavors.
  • 2 cups chicken broth: Use low-sodium if you prefer less salt; it really enhances the dish.
  • 1/2 cup pesto: Store-bought or homemade, it adds that delightful herbal kick!
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ved: These bring a sweet burst of flavor that pairs perfectly with the orzo.
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ese: A sprinkle on top adds a lovely cheesy finish.
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il: For cooking the chicken and adding richness to the dish.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Essential for seasoning; don’t skip this step to elevate all those flavors!

How to Prepare One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o

Now, let’s get cooking! Making One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o is a breeze, and I’m here to guide you through each step. You’ll have a delicious meal ready in no time, so let’s dive in!

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Start by heating the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. You want it nice and hot, but not smoking!
  2. While the oil is warming, season your chicken breasts generously with salt and pepper. This is key for making sure they’re flavorful!
  3. Carefully place the chicken in the skillet and c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side until they’re golden brown. Don’t rush this step; that lovely color adds so much flavor!
  4. Once the chicken is cooked, remove it from the skillet and set it aside on a plate. This gives it a chance to rest and keeps it juicy.
  5. Now, it’s time to add the orzo and chicken broth to the same skillet. Bring it to a bo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for about 10 minutes.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.
  6. After the orzo has absorbed most of the broth, stir in the pesto, halved cherry tomatoes, and Parmesan cheese. The colors and aromas will be amazing!
  7. Slice the rested chicken and return it to the skillet. Cook everything together for an additional 2 minutes to heat through.
  8. And voilà! Your One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o is ready to serve. Just plate it up and enjoy the deliciousness!

Tips for Success

To make your One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o truly shine, here are some insider tips! First, when seasoning the chicken, don’t be shy—really coat it with salt and pepper for the best flavor. Also, make sure your skillet is hot enough before adding the chicken; this helps achieve that gorgeous golden crust that we all love!

If your orzo seems too dry during cooking, don’t hesitate to add a splash more chicken broth. It should be creamy, not dry! And remember, allow the chicken to rest after cooking; this keeps it juicy and tender. Lastly, feel free to experiment with different veggies like spinach or bell peppers for extra color and nutrients. Trust me, you can’t go wrong with this dish!

FAQ Section

Can I use a different type of pasta? Absolutely! While orzo gives a unique texture, you can substitute it with other small pasta shapes like ditalini or even whole wheat pasta. Just keep an eye on the cooking time!

What can I add to the dish for extra veggies? Great question! You can definitely toss in some fresh spinach, bell peppers, or even zucchini. Just add them during the last few minutes of cooking so they stay vibrant and tender.

Can I make this dish ahead of time? Yes, you can! Just prepare everything as directed, let it cool, and store it in an airtight container in the fridge.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ply reheat it on the stove or microwave, adding a splash of broth if needed.

What should I serve with One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o? This dish is pretty complete on its own, but a simple green salad or some garlic bread pairs beautifully! It adds a nice crunch and balances out the creamy orzo.

Can I freeze leftovers? Yes, you can freeze One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o. Just make sure to store it in a freezer-safe container. It should keep well for about 2-3 months. When you’re ready to eat, thaw it in the fridge overnight before reheating.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Storing your One Pan Chicken & Pesto Orzo is super easy! After you’ve finished your meal, let any leftovers cool down to room temperature. Then, transfer them to an airtight container and pop it in the fridge. This dish will stay fresh for about 3-4 days, so you can enjoy it throughout the week!

When you’re ready to dig in again, reheating is a breeze! You can either warm it up on the stovetop or in the microwave. If using the stovetop, add a splash of chicken broth to keep it creamy and prevent it from drying out. Heat over medium until it’s warmed through, stirring occasionally. In the microwave, just cover the bowl and heat in 30-second intervals, stirring in between. It’ll be just as delicious as the first time around—enjoy!
